The closest thing to YNAB's zero-based budgeting philosophy at a fraction of the cost. Self-hostable, open-source, and backed by a strong community of YNAB refugees.
A genuinely free budgeting app that real users stick with long-term. Handles manual entry and bank uploads well, making it a solid no-cost YNAB replacement.

Our take
If you loved YNAB's envelope method and hate the subscription price, Actual Budget is where you go. The community has spoken loudly and clearly on this one.
Buddy doesn't get the hype of Monarch or Actual, but it's the pick if you want free and functional without rolling your own spreadsheet.
